Great to hear from Anthony Morrow – Community Connector Manager at Sanctuary Scotland at the #TISMemberGathering, discussing their Community Connectors model, which combines Asset Based Community Development and Trauma Informed Practice through their Connectors.💭✨

There’s still time to take part in a national research study that aims to pave the way for a more inclusive future for TP & engagement practices in Scotland.
📢Deadline extended – there is still time to share your views and provide insight on tenant participation and engagement amongst tenants from ethnic minority backgrounds.
Social housing providers have until Friday 20th June at 5pm to share their views:
